Sunday September 23rd at 5 pm STANDING SILENT A Jewish community is scandalized when journalist Phil Jacobs uncovers a pattern of child sexual abuse at the hands of prominent rabbis. Through a multiyear investigation, Jacobs confronts both the rabbinic establishment and his own painful past. Recipient of a Sundance Documentary Filmmaker Grant, this taboo-breaking film recounts how a courageous reporter’s pen became his sword of justice.
SPEAK NO EVIL… UNLESS IT’S THE TRUTH! A Q&A WITH Phil Jacobs and filmmaker Scott Rosenfelt will follow the screening, moderated by Rabbi Hesch Sommer, D. Min., of Jewish Family Services
